• Call: +91-900-306-9000
  • Email: Vijay.Venkadesh@Fhyzics.Net

Mastering Power BI: Unlocking the Power of Data Visualization and Analytics

Power BI Training

The Complete Power BI DAX Training: Unlocking Advanced Functions

  • March 6 2025
  • Vijay V
The Complete Power BI DAX Training: Unlocking Advanced Functions

DAX (Data Analysis Expressions) is the key to unlocking advanced calculations and data modeling in Power BI. Whether you're a beginner or an experienced user, mastering DAX functions can significantly enhance your ability to create complex reports and extract deeper insights. This Power BI DAX training guide will help you understand advanced DAX functions and how they can improve your data analysis skills. 

1. Understanding the Power of DAX 

DAX is a formula language used in Power BI, Excel, and SQL Server Analysis Services to perform custom calculations on data. Unlike basic Excel formulas, DAX allows you to create dynamic measures, aggregate functions, and time-based calculations that adapt to user interactions. This makes it an essential skill for professionals working with large datasets. 


2. Advanced DAX Functions for Powerful Analytics 

To fully leverage Power BI’s capabilities, you need to master some of the most important advanced DAX functions:

  • CALCULATE: The most powerful DAX function, used to modify filter contexts and create dynamic aggregations. 
  • FILTER: Helps refine data based on specific conditions, often used with CALCULATE for complex queries.  
  • ALL & ALLEXCEPT: Removes filters from a dataset to perform comparative calculations and advanced reporting. 
  • RANKX: Allows you to rank data based on specific metrics, essential for leaderboard-style reports. 
  • TIME INTELLIGENCE (TOTALYTD, SAMEPERIODLASTYEAR, DATESYTD): These functions enable advanced time-based comparisons, making them ideal for financial and sales reporting. 

3. Optimizing Performance with DAX Best Practices 

Writing efficient DAX code ensures that Power BI reports run smoothly, even with large datasets. Follow these best practices:

  • Use variables (VAR) to simplify complex calculations and improve readability. 
  • Optimize performance by reducing unnecessary filters in calculations. 
  • Utilize aggregations instead of row-based calculations for faster processing. 


4. Real-World Applications of Advanced DAX 

Advanced DAX is widely used across industries for: 

  • Sales analysis: Comparing revenue growth using year-over-year calculations. 
  • Financial modeling: Creating profit margin and forecasting models. 
  • HR analytics: Tracking employee performance and retention trends. 

Final Thoughts 

Mastering DAX in Power BI allows you to unlock the full potential of data analytics and build dynamic, insightful reports. Whether you're analyzing business trends or optimizing financial data, DAX skills give you a competitive edge. 

 


This Article is Uploaded by: Gokul K

Keywords:
Power BI DAX training, DAX functions in Power BI, Advanced DAX in Power BI, Power BI DAX tutorial, DAX for data analysis, Power BI DAX formulas, Learn DAX in Power BI, Power BI DAX best practices, Power BI DAX course, DAX advanced functions, Power BI DAX mastery, DAX for beginners, DAX vs M language, DAX time intelligence functions, DAX filter functions, DAX for financial analysis, DAX performance optimization, DAX for business intelligence, DAX calculated columns, DAX measures vs calculated columns, DAX expressions in Power BI, DAX conditional statements, DAX logical functions, DAX SUMX vs SUM, DAX ALL vs ALLEXCEPT, DAX data modeling techniques, DAX filter context vs row context, Power BI DAX for beginners, DAX aggregation functions, DAX iteration functions, DAX ranking functions, DAX advanced calculations, DAX variables in Power BI, DAX for dynamic reporting, Power BI DAX practical examples, Power BI DAX real-world applications, DAX for business reporting, DAX SWITCH function, DAX CALCULATE function, DAX RELATED function, DAX RELATEDTABLE function, DAX EARLIER function, DAX LOOKUPVALUE function, DAX ALLSELECTED function, DAX FILTER function in Power BI, DAX ROW function, DAX GENERATESERIES function, DAX FORMAT function, DAX advanced data modeling, DAX calculated tables, DAX optimization techniques, Power BI DAX vs SQL, DAX variables best practices, DAX context transition, DAX complex calculations, DAX percentile calculations, DAX RANKX function in Power BI, DAX cumulative totals, DAX moving averages, DAX advanced chart calculations, DAX performance tuning in Power BI, DAX with Power Query, DAX with multiple tables, DAX nested functions, DAX advanced measures, DAX complex filters, DAX combining functions, DAX formula examples, DAX troubleshooting techniques, DAX in financial reporting, DAX for KPI calculations, DAX for marketing analytics, DAX for sales analysis, DAX for HR analytics, DAX in supply chain analysis, DAX time series analysis, DAX for real-time analytics, DAX for executive dashboards, DAX cross-filtering techniques, DAX for forecasting, DAX percentile calculations in Power BI, DAX cumulative totals vs running totals, DAX advanced partitioning, DAX top N analysis, DAX bottom N analysis, DAX scenario analysis, DAX percentile ranking, DAX debugging techniques, DAX for large datasets, DAX performance benchmarking, DAX data transformation, DAX advanced aggregations, DAX and Power Automate integration, DAX vs Excel formulas, DAX scripting best practices, DAX skills for Power BI certification, DAX workshop training, DAX business case studies, DAX for enterprise solutions, DAX project-based learning, DAX hands-on training, DAX professional certification preparation. 

Share on:

Leave Your Comment Here